38-2013. Graduate medical education or residency, defined.

Graduate medical education or residency means a program of supervised educational training, approved by the board, in a medical specialty at an accredited hospital, an accredited school or college of medicine, or an accredited school or college of osteopathic medicine, that follows the completion of undergraduate medical education.

Source
    Laws 2007, LB463, ยง 671.
